Sierra Cup Mountain Bike Racing Series


image_pdfimage_print

The Sierra Cup Mountain Bike Racing Series wraps up the 2011 season on Oct. 2 with the Sawtooth Ridge Challenge at Northstar-at-Tahoe.

The Sierra Cup is a seven race point series to determine the USA Cycling cross-country mountain bike champions for the Northern California/Nevada region.

The Sawtooth Ridge Challenge, like the other Sierra Cup events, is donating event proceeds to bicycle related causes. Benefiting from this race will be the Truckee Trails Foundation and the Northstar/Giant development team. The series events have also partnered with Waste Not in Incline Village to meet or exceed zero-waste standards.

Racers will ride a 7-mile course that was developed by Northstar Resort for last year’s Collegiate National Championships. Racers will complete multiple laps of the course depending on their ability category. The course will have a mix of trails that include small features like jumps, berms and technical descents. The climbs are spread out to allow time for riders to recover.

There are age and ability categories for all levels of riders. Custom recycled medals are awarded to the top finishers in each category as well as series points. After the race awards, there will be a podium ceremony for the overall series winners. Besides the regional championship medals from USA Cycling, there is also a $1,500 series purse for top riders.
